Rochdale dates for your diary - spring / summer 2025

SAT 5 APRILRIVERSIDE ARTISAN MARKETRochdale Riverside10am - 4pm

The popular Riverside Artisan Market now takes place on the first Saturday and the last Sunday of every month, offering a diverse array of unique handmade goods and quality artisan products. Further dates: 27 April, 3 May & 25 May, 7 & 29 June, 5 & 27 July, 2 & 31 August

SAT 21 JUNEHEYWOOD 1940S DAYHeywood - various locations

A popular annual event which last year included an armed forces parade, afternoon dance, 1940s entertainment, charity stalls, armoured and vintage vehicles, live music and lots more! Details on this year's event are soon to be announced. Find out more at: facebook.com/heywood1940sday

FRI 4 JULYTHE HERDS

Life size animal puppets will take over the streets of Heywood as part of Manchester International Festival and Rochdale, Greater Manchester Town of Culture in a breathtaking, untamed spectacle. Discover more at: factoryinternational.org/whats-on/theherds
